The Upsiders is a podcast that serves as a time capsule into the brighter side of today’s world. The Upsiders’ podcast aims to highlight positive stories, trends, and cultural moments that often go overlooked. The show’s tagline, ”The Time Traveler’s Guide to the Present,” emphasizes its focus on exploring the present day through a unique and optimistic lens.

    The Night Shift Society | How Cities are Waking Up to the Night Economy

    The city doesn't sleep. It just changes shifts.While most of the world is tucked in, roughly 20% of the workforce in industrialized nations is just getting started. This isn't just about the "party-goers" or the "night owls"; this is the Night Shift Society: the essential healthcare professionals, logistics experts, manufacturing operators, and sanitation crews who serve as the metabolism of our modern world.In this episode of The Upsiders, we’re pulling back the curtain on the "Invisible City."
